Job DescriptionJob DescriptionCOMMUNICATORServes as the primary point of contact for all parties involved, including agents, buyers and sellers in the preparatory phase of real estate closings, ensuring a seamless and organized process. Provides exceptional customer service and consistent and clear communication to all parties involved and completes all tasks in accordance with company SOPs.Key ResponsibilitiesCore Duties: Make introductory calls to buyers/sellersandallagents once new contract is openedCommunicate important wire fraud information to buyers and agents, when neededReview and confirm information provided by selling agent to ensure accuracy and completion prior to closingProvide file status updates to buyersand agentsIdentify and escalate issuesin a timely manner and ensure resolution is obtained and communicated to appropriate partiesComplete assigned tasks within the established time frames and in accordance with company SOPs Communication: Communicate with clients, real estate agents, lenders, and other stakeholders to gather necessary information and documentation.Facilitate smooth communication throughout the process to include:Introductory callsWeek 1 check in calls2 weeks prior to closing calls1 week prior to closing calls1 day prior to closing callsOn record phone calls after closing Verify Buyer WireFraud Video Completion and escalate to PreCloser if incomplete.Execute required call cadence: Notify Buyer/Agent whenTitle is Complete.Thankyoucall to Buyer’s Agent within1 business day.Intro call to Buyer within2 business days.2Weeks Prior to Closing: confirm details with both Agent & Buyer.1Week Prior: provide status update.Day Before Closing: confirmation calls to Buyer and Agent.1Day PostClosing: followup call with Agent.
